北祁连山白山子花岗闪长岩成岩时代

摘    要:寒山大型金矿是近年来在北祁连山西段发现的与侵人岩有关的构造蚀变岩型金矿。笔者首次利用锆石U-Pb方法测得白山子花岗闪长岩的形成年龄为370±25 Ma,属于华力西期。寒山金矿的成矿主要在213.95~339 Ma间。在多期热液叠加,多期成矿作用中,早期成矿的热液很可能是白山子花岗闪长岩(370±25 Ma) ,寒山辉长岩(347.1±6. 4 Ma)共同提供的。由于该区有较多的中酸性岩体存在,它们可能为金的主要来源,因而,确定这些侵入体的形成年龄,对于在该区寻找蚀变岩型金矿不仅有重要的理论意义,而且有重要的现实意义。

A Preliminay Study of the Petrogenic Age of Granodiorite in Baishanzhi, North Qilian Mountains

Abstract:The Hanshan gold deposit is a tectonic altered rock type deposit discovered recently in North Qilian Mountains. The formation age of Baishanzhi granodiorite measured by U-Pb method is 370±25 Ma, indicating the Hercynian period. The metallogenic age of the Hanshan gold deposit is 213.95~339 Ma. Among the superimpositions of multi-stage hydrothermal fluids and multi-stage mineralizations, the ore-fornring hydrothermal solution of the early stage was probably provided jointly by Baishanzhi granodiorite (370±25 Ma) and Hanshan diorite (347.1±6.4 Ma). As there exist lots of intermediate-acid rocks, it is obvious that the rocks might serve as the major gold sources. The determination of the formation ages of these intrusives is of great theoretical and practical significance in search for altered rock type gold deposits in this area.
